    1. Gipsy Bar

    Gipsy Bar is renowned for its authentic reggae vibes and loyal following. Every Friday, the club transforms into a reggae haven, featuring live performances by talented reggae bands and DJs. The atmosphere is electric, and the dance floor is always packed with people grooving to the rhythm. The sound system is top-notch, ensuring that you'll feel every bassline and skank. Gipsy Bar also offers a wide selection of drinks and delicious food to keep you energized throughout the night. It's a great place to meet fellow reggae enthusiasts and experience the true spirit of Kenyan reggae culture. The bar often hosts special events and guest artists, so be sure to check their social media pages for updates.

    2. Memphis Bar & Restaurant

    Memphis Bar & Restaurant is another fantastic option for Friday reggae nights in Nairobi. This spot offers a more laid-back and intimate atmosphere, making it perfect for those who prefer a relaxed setting. The reggae music is carefully curated, featuring a mix of classic hits and contemporary tunes. The bar also serves a variety of cocktails and beers, as well as tasty bites to eat. Memphis Bar & Restaurant is a great place to unwind after a long week and enjoy some good music with friends. The staff are friendly and welcoming, creating a comfortable and enjoyable experience for everyone. Keep an eye out for their themed reggae nights and special promotions.

    3. Club Natives

    Club Natives is a popular spot among Nairobi's younger crowd, and their Friday reggae nights are always a hit. The club features a state-of-the-art sound system and lighting, creating a vibrant and energetic atmosphere. The DJs at Club Natives are known for their eclectic mixes, blending reggae with dancehall and other genres. The dance floor is always packed, and the energy is contagious. Club Natives also offers a VIP section for those who want a more exclusive experience. The bar serves a wide range of drinks, including signature cocktails and local beers. If you're looking for a high-energy reggae night, Club Natives is the place to be. They frequently host guest DJs and artists, so check their schedule for upcoming events.

    4. Klub House

    Klub House is a well-established Nairobi nightclub that regularly hosts reggae nights, and Fridays are no exception. Known for its spacious dance floor and powerful sound system, Klub House offers a proper clubbing experience with a reggae twist. Expect a mix of local and international reggae tunes, spun by some of Nairobi's most talented DJs. The club attracts a diverse crowd, making it a great place to socialize and meet new people. Klub House also features a large bar area serving a wide variety of drinks. The club often hosts themed nights and special events, so be sure to check their website or social media pages for updates. If you're looking for a classic nightclub experience with a reggae soundtrack, Klub House is a great choice.

    5. The Alchemist Bar

    The Alchemist Bar is known for its eclectic events and vibrant atmosphere. While not exclusively a reggae club, they often host reggae nights on Fridays that are worth checking out. The Alchemist attracts a trendy crowd and offers a unique outdoor setting, complete with food trucks and art installations. The music is usually a mix of reggae, dancehall, and Afrobeat, creating a diverse and energetic vibe. The bar serves a wide variety of drinks, including craft cocktails and local beers. The Alchemist Bar is a great place to experience Nairobi's alternative nightlife scene and enjoy some good reggae music. Check their event schedule to see when the next reggae night is planned.

    The Enduring Appeal of Reggae Music in Nairobi

    So, why is reggae music so popular in Nairobi? The answer lies in the music's message of peace, love, and unity. Reggae's positive vibrations resonate with people from all walks of life, and its themes of social justice and equality speak to the hearts of many Kenyans. Reggae music also has a strong connection to African culture, with many reggae artists drawing inspiration from African rhythms and melodies. The genre fosters a sense of community and belonging, bringing people together through the power of music. The infectious rhythms and catchy melodies of reggae make it irresistible to dance to, and the lyrics often tell stories that are both relatable and thought-provoking.
